Output 43a362401a24afc517f2828613cc1a6a152800e3eb731d4f5dae5435be5b0787:0

value
529752
script pubkey
OP_0 OP_PUSHBYTES_20 ecfcdccaa061b797c51249254a7dc490bba64e76
address
bc1qan7dej4qvxme03gjfyj55lwyjza6vnnkuj89sm
transaction
43a362401a24afc517f2828613cc1a6a152800e3eb731d4f5dae5435be5b0787
spent
true